Dictionary Definition
destination
Noun
1 the place designated as the end (as of a race
or journey); "a crowd assembled at the finish"; "he was nearly
exhuasted as their destination came into view" [syn: finish, goal]
2 the ultimate goal for which something is done
[syn: terminus]
3 written directions for finding some location;
written on letters or packages that are to be delivered to that
location [syn: address,
name and
address]

Extensive Definition
Destination was a disco studio group from New York who had
two chart entries: "Move On Up" / "Up Up Up" / "Destination's
Theme," which spent four weeks at #1 on the
Hot Dance Music/Club Play chart in 1979, and : "My Number
One Request"/"From Mortishia To Gomez Addams" (which consisted of
parts from the original
Addams Family theme song) spent three weeks at #1 on the
Hot Dance Music/Club Play chart in 1980. A trio,
Destination consisted of Danny Lugo, Kathleen
Bradley and Love Chyle Theus.
